WTF?! Not for the first time, a government organization has issued a warning over a new online trend that sounds too stupid to be real. The latest TikTok craze putting people's lives at risk is the "sleepy chicken" challenge. It involves cooking chicken in NyQuil or another over-the-counter cough and cold medication, presumably to eat it.
